The Pakistan Football Federation (PFF) on Monday announced its 20-member team to take part in the Islamic Solidarity Games football championship being held in Saudi Arabia from April 9. "The team led by Wapda's defender Tanveer Ahmad and army's Jaffar Khan as its vice captain was approved by President, PFF, Faisal Saleh Hayat,", said a spokesman of the PFF.
FOLLOWING IS THE SQUAD: (Goalkeepers) Jaffar Khan and Muhammad Shahzad (Defenders) Muhammad Shahid, Mehmood Khan, Muhammad Imran, Aurangzeb, Tanveer Ahmed,Yasir Sabir and Ijaz Ahmed. (Mid fielders) Imran Niazi, Zahid Hameed, Atiqur Rehman, and Mohammad Zahid. (Strikers) Muhammad Essa, Arif Mahmood, Farooq Shah, Abdul Aziz, Imran Hussain,Naveed Akram and Shahid Ahmed.
He said in the 16-country football competition Pakistan has been placed in Group D along with Morocco, Kuwait and Malaysia.
FOLLOWING IS THE FORMATION OF GROUPS:
(Group A) Iran, Oman, Sudan and Tajikistan
(Group B) Cameroon, Mali, Syria and Chad
(Group C) Saudi Arabia, Algeria, Palestine and Yemen
(Group D) Pakistan, Morocco, Kuwait and Malaysia
He said Pakistan will launch its campaign in the event by taking on strong Northwest African nation Morocco in their match on April 9.
"The credit of entering Pakistani team into Islamic Games's soccer tourney goes to President, PFF as in the past the national football federation used to withdraw it's teams from competitions, the worst example being the 1984 and 1995 SAF Games", he maintained.
FOLLOWING IS THE PROGRAMME OF MATCHES:
(April 9) Mali vs Syria, Algeria vs Palestine, Kuwait vs Malaysia, Morocco vs Pakistan, Saudi Arabia vs Yemen, Cameroon vs Chad.
(April 10) Oman vs Sudan, Imran vs Tajikistan.
(April 11) Saudi Arabia vs Palestine, Cameroon vs Syria, Morocco vs Malaysia, Pakistan vs Kuwait, Chad vs Mali, Yemen vs Algeria.
(April 12) Iran vs Sudan, Tajikistan vs Oman.
(April 13) Syria vs Chad, Palestine vs Yemen, Malaysia vs Pakistan, Morocco vs Kuwait, Saudi Arabia vs Algeria.
(April 14) Sudan vs Tajikistan, Iran vs Oman.
(April 15 and 16) quarter finals.
(April 18) semi finals)
(April 20) third place match and the final.
